How to make Mango manzeera -

A type of raw mango chutney.

History of Indian cuisine dates back to nearly 5,000-years ago when various groups and cultures interacted with India that led to a diversity of flavours and regional cuisines.
Indian cuisine comprises of a number of regional cuisines.  The diversity in soil type, climate, culture, ethnic group and occupations, these cuisines differ from each other mainly due to the use of locally available spices, herbs, vegetables and fruits. Indian food is also influenced by religious and cultural choices and traditions. 
Foreign invasions, trade relations and colonialism had introduced certain foods to the country like potato, chillies and breadfruit.    

Prep Time : 41-50 minutes

Cook time : 16-20 minutes

Serve : 4

Level Of Cooking : Easy

Taste : Tangy

Ingredients for Mango manzeera Recipe

  • Raw Mango cut into cubes 10

  • Sugar 3 tablespoons

  • Onion seeds (kalonji) 2 tablespoons

  • Fenugreek seeds (methi dana) 2 tablespoon

  • Black peppercorns 8-10

  • Fennel seeds (saunf) 2 tablespoons

  • Cloves 8-10

  • Sugar 1 cup

Method

Step 1

Heat olive oil in a non-stick pan. Add onion seeds, methi seeds, black peppercorns, fennel seeds and cloves and saute for a minute.

Step 2

Add mangoes and saute for five minutes or till the moisture get evaporated.

Step 3

Add sugar and cook for two minutes. Remove the pan from heat and store in airtight containers. Serve with paranthas.
